But if they have ipyvtk_simple and pyvista < 0.30 it should work, right? For example:
kwargs = dict()
if LooseVersion(pyvista.__version__) < LooseVersion('0.30'):
kwargs['jupyter_backend' ] = 'ipyvtk_simple'
else:
kwargs['jupyter_backend'] = 'ipyvtklink'
viewer = self.plotter.show(return_viewer=True, **kwargs)
